Reel Club Oakbrook IL

I wanted to share some info I found out while dining at a restaurant last night. It was the first time I went to the Reel Club in Oakbrook. It is next to Maggianos. After gobbling up some yummy rolls I asked our server Olga if they had a gluten free menu. And the typical questions after..does the entire staff know about GF and the cross contamination issues and etc. She went on and on how everyone is trained. And when an allergy request is made, there are several steps taken all the way to the way its entered in the system to different tags placed on the order. She said they take it very seriously! They do not have a special menu but can go over everything that you can eat, or modify what you would like. The grouper I had was awesome and the fillet my daughter had was GREAT! Then she told me something that just about knocked my socks off. The rolls we are eating are GLUTEN FREE! They hand make them there..tapioca flour and such. WOW..I told her I would be bringing my hubby in (David) to eat here for sure! She sent me home with 7 rolls for David to try. HE LOVED THEM! If you go, ask for her, she was nice and knew it all. Although she tells me they all are well versed on this. Its not cheap but not really expensive. You can see the menu on line. She told me the roll recipe was on line but I couldn't find it.
